Conduct Disorder
A psychological disorder in children and adolescents characterized by a persistent pattern of behavior that violates social norms and the rights of others.
Prevention Programs
Initiatives designed to stop an issue before it occurs, focusing on interventions that can prevent harm or disease.
Anger Coping
Anger coping involves strategies and techniques used to manage and reduce feelings of anger and its expression in healthy, constructive ways.
Coping Power Program
A preventive intervention that seeks to improve children's coping strategies and social competence.
